For optimal performance in this 2D action-adventure platformer, an entry-level GPU like the GTX 1650 or RX 6500 XT is recommended. This setup will handle the game smoothly at 1080p resolution with medium settings. Given its relatively simple graphics and design, the game is quite accessible, making it a great choice for players with budget-friendly rigs.
Players using lower-tier GPUs might still enjoy the experience by lowering the resolution to 720p or adjusting settings to low. With just 1 GB of RAM required, even older systems can run it, making it appealing for casual gamers or those revisiting older hardware.
